I currently am in the process of setting up a 150gl reef tank, the total water volume will be about 200-220gl. It will have 2 400wt halides and 2 110wt PC. There is no hood or top to the tank. I know I'm wanting a 75gpd unit, I live in chillicothe so we have city water which I believe will deliver the proper water pressure needed(Hopefully). I'm torn between the Premium series and the Chloramine special. The Reef series comes with little more than I need I think.
I don't think I would need the pressure tank with my water supply being enough. That is what the pressure tank is for correct?
So back to the premium and chloramine series. How do I go about finding out if my water contains enough chloramine to need that particular series. I have obtained a water analysis from my local water company and it does not say anything about chloramines? So any advice would be great!
